Patricia Ann Mayfield

Patricia Ann Mayfield, beloved daughter, sister, and aunt, passed away on Saturday, June 7, at the age of 74 in Gatesville, Texas. Pat’s memorial service will be held at 2:00 p.m. on Wednesday, June 18, at Scott’s Funeral Home. The family will welcome visitors one hour prior to the service at the funeral home. Burial will follow at the family’s Home Place Cemetery.

Pat was born in Fort Worth, Texas, on November 13, 1950, to Milton Bud Pollard and Billie Greer Pollard. At the age of 10, she accepted Christ as her Lord and Savior and was baptized at Mountain Baptist Church in Gatesville. All of her school years were spent in Gatesville, where she was a member of the class of 1969. She praised her teachers who helped her gain the confidence and poise that shaped her future.

Pat lived in Gulfport, Houston, and Victoria. On October 1, 1979, she married Tim Mayfield, and they moved to Gatesville in 1981. They built a home on the family land where she grew up, and they had many happy years together.

She worked at Texas Farm Bureau for 33 years as a claims adjuster and supervisor, retiring in 2010. Retirement gave her more time to focus on the things she enjoyed, such as reading, watching old westerns and classic TV shows, and playing eighty-four and board and card games. Pat led the way for family gatherings during the holidays. She enjoyed shopping throughout the year for her family, and her homemade fudge at Christmas was a savored tradition. Her generosity was unmatched.

When Pat was diagnosed with cancer, she hoped to remain in her home as long as possible. In recent months, family and friends, whom she called her “special angels,” assisted and cared for her every day.

Pat was preceded in death by her parents and her husband. She is survived by her sisters, Penny Whitaker (George) and Peggy Baize (Allen); her brother, Paul Pollard (Evelyn); and her brother-in-law, Carl Mayfield (Kathy). She took great pride in her nieces, Lesli Baker (Daniel), Lauren Whitaker, Marissa Mayfield, and Valerie Medina; and her nephews, Barrett Pollard (Caroline), Joshua Baize, and Jarrod Dunahoo (Kim). Pat also doted on her great nieces and nephews, Gabriel, Emma, Claire, Oliver, Dillon, Levi, and Meredith.

Pat will always be in our hearts.
